AI and the News: AI's Role in News Creation
AI is changing the field of journalism, offering new ways to generate news content. Traditionally, news articles were painstakingly crafted by reporters, but now, automated platforms can examine vast amounts of information and transform it into understandable news stories. This technique typically begins with gathering data from various platforms, such as official statements, economic data, and social media feeds. Advanced programs then pinpoint key facts and relationships within the data, arranging them into a logical narrative. The AI can then write a draft article, often mimicking the voice of a human writer. However AI-generated articles are not yet perfect, they are becoming more refined, and are already being used by media companies to cover standard topics like financial results and sports scores. The future of journalism likely involves a synergy between AI and human journalists, where AI handles the basic tasks and human journalists focus on complex storytelling and verifying facts.
The Ethics of AI-Generated News: Examining the Implications
The increasing use of artificial intelligence in news creation presents a novel set of issues to consider. AI provides the potential for faster news delivery and customized reporting, it also raises concerns about accuracy, prejudice, and accountability. One key concern is the potential for AI to generate inaccurate information, especially when using flawed datasets. Importantly is the question of liability when AI-generated news contains mistakes or damaging content. Establishing responsibility – the developers, the publishers, or the AI itself – is a thorny issue. In addition, the limited human intervention in AI-driven news production can amplify these concerns. Detailed evaluation of these challenges is crucial to ensure that AI is used responsibly in the field of journalism and that the public is well-informed and trustworthy.
